常用的正則表達式 pattern的用法,只是列出來一些常用的正則: 信用卡 [0-9]{13,16} 銀聯卡 ^62[0-5]\d{13,16}$ Visa: ^4[0-9]{12}(?:[0-9]{3})?$ 萬事達:^5[1-5][0-9]{14}$ QQ號碼: [1-9][0-9 ...
一: 正則在Perl Py森 Ruby Java等語言中文本的正則表達式幾乎是一樣的 以前常用到的在網上都有現成的例子拿來用,比如電話格式 郵箱格式之類的。 但是自然語言處理中往往會根據自己的需求來制定一個表達式,如果正則的知識掌握的比較片面,在編寫自然語言處理程序時可能會覺得苦惱。 在 自然語言處理簡明教程 里面有很系統的正則表達式教程,特意總結出來消化吸收。 二: 雙斜線 最簡單的正則表達式就 ...
2016-08-01 22:05 1 31310 推薦指數:
常用的正則表達式 pattern的用法,只是列出來一些常用的正則: 信用卡 [0-9]{13,16} 銀聯卡 ^62[0-5]\d{13,16}$ Visa: ^4[0-9]{12}(?:[0-9]{3})?$ 萬事達:^5[1-5][0-9]{14}$ QQ號碼: [1-9][0-9 ...
在Django中,正則表達式所捕獲的參數都是字符串類型的。 如下所示:(不是很全,后期本人遇到再加) 正則表達式 意義 \d{4} \d:表示匹配數字 {4}:表示只匹配4位數字 \w \w:表示 ...
...
'正則表達式的核心是設置對比的規則,也就是設置Pattern屬性,而組成這些規則除了字符本身以外,是具有特定含義的符號。 '下面介紹的是正規表達式中常用符號的第一部分。 '\號 '1.放在不便書寫的字符前面,如換行符(\r),回車符(\n),制表符(\t),\自身(\\) '2.放在有特殊 ...
正則表達式 正則表達式是由一些字符和特殊符號組成的字符串,他們描述了模式的重復或表述多個字符,於是正則表達式能按照某種模式匹配一系列有相似特征的字符串。也即它們能匹配多個字符串。 常用特殊字符和符號 0.擇一匹配 (|) | 從多個模式中選擇其一,類似於邏輯 ...
正則表達式---常用符號 首先聲明,我這里列表的是經常使用的一些符號,如果你想得到全部,那建議你通過API中,搜索Pattern類,會得到所有符號。 字符類 [abc] a、b 或 c(簡單類) [^abc ...
正則表達式 正則表達式有一個定界符, /(開頭)表達式 /(結尾) ^匹配開頭,以什么開頭 。$匹配結尾 指用什么結尾 * 加內容,指內容可以出現任意次,大於等於0次,可以有0次 + 加內容 ,指可以出現一次或者多次 最少一次,不能為 ...
1.指定開頭,指定結尾 2.匹配所有整型數字 3.匹配所有浮點數 4.匹配無視空格和換行 5.匹配或者 ...